Transaction 33280207419b39df05fdca6451b76019979e666ce76300ffeb384858b0598915
1 Input
1 Output
-
33280207419b39df05fdca6451b76019979e666ce76300ffeb384858b0598915:0
- value
- 708183
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7085b51f79672f46022dd8dae6f63bf1592f8d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LbzHsxa6Spny5RjMVTMB4doFdFFixeBbX